Đinh Đinh GitHub phá vỡ các hòn đảo thông tin, tái thiết lập nhịp độ nhóm
Giá trị cốt lõi của Đinh Đinh GitHub không nằm ở việc đơn thuần chuyển thông báo GitHub vào phòng chat, mà nằm ở việc hoàn toàn xóa bỏ các hòn đảo thông tin trong quy trình phát triển. Trong mô hình làm việc truyền thống, kỹ sư phải chủ động chuyển đổi nền tảng để theo dõi trạng thái PR, chờ phản hồi CI/CD, thậm chí dựa vào trao đổi lời nói hoặc tin nhắn nhóm để xác nhận tiến độ — cơ chế tra cứu thụ động này rất dễ gây chậm trễ và sai lệch. Khi một lần merge quan trọng xảy ra, nếu không ai thông báo kịp thời cho đội kiểm thử, việc triển khai có thể bị đình trệ cả nửa ngày; email báo lỗi CI chìm sâu dưới hộp thư, đến khi phát hiện thì thường đã lãng phí rất nhiều tài nguyên. Chính vì những điểm đau này mà tích hợp Đinh Đinh GitHub được thiết kế — nó biến mỗi sự kiện mã nguồn thành ngữ cảnh tập thể rõ ràng và cảm nhận được. Sau khi cấu hình hoàn tất, mỗi lần push, mở issue hay pipeline sập sẽ được gửi ngay lập tức dưới dạng tin nhắn cấu trúc đến nhóm chỉ định, giống như lắp đặt một "hệ thống phản xạ thần kinh" cho toàn bộ nhóm. Tinh tế hơn, sự minh bạch này không chỉ tăng tốc độ phản ứng mà còn vô hình trung củng cố trách nhiệm cá nhân và sức gắn kết nhóm. PM không cần phải hỏi "Có ai coi chưa?" nữa, vì mọi người đều nhận thông tin trên cùng một kênh, hợp tác từ xa cũng như đang ngồi chung bàn cùng theo dõi repo.
Đinh Đinh GitHub xây dựng robot kết nối webhook từ con số 0
Để đạt được hiệu ứng cộng tác giữa Đinh Đinh và GitHub, bước đầu tiên là thiết lập cầu nối giao tiếp hai chiều. Trước tiên, vào mục "Thiết lập nhóm" → "Robot" → "Thêm robot tùy chỉnh" trong nhóm Đinh Đinh mục tiêu, chọn "Webhook tùy chỉnh" để tạo URL. Liên kết độc nhất này chính là "người đưa tin kỹ thuật số" của bạn, chịu trách nhiệm truyền nhịp đập từ GitHub trực tiếp vào luồng trò chuyện nhóm. Sau đó chuyển sang Settings > Webhooks trong kho lưu trữ GitHub, dán URL webhook Đinh Đinh vừa lấy được. Trong phần điều kiện kích hoạt sự kiện, bạn có thể lựa chọn các thao tác then chốt như push, pull_request, issues hoặc deployments theo nhu cầu nhóm. Vấn đề an ninh tuyệt đối không thể bỏ qua: nhất định phải thiết lập Secret Token và bật xác thực chữ ký (X-Hub-Signature), ngăn chặn yêu cầu giả mạo làm rối loạn quy trình. Những lỗi phổ biến như 400 Bad Request thường do định dạng payload không phù hợp hoặc thất bại trong việc khớp token, lúc này nên tận dụng chức năng "Recent Deliveries" do GitHub cung cấp để lần lượt kiểm tra nội dung yêu cầu và trạng thái phản hồi, nhanh chóng xác định vấn đề. Sau khi thành công, mọi lần gửi mã sẽ tự động kích hoạt thông báo Đinh Đinh, chấm dứt hoàn toàn thời đại báo cáo thủ công.
Đinh Đinh GitHub xây dựng cơ chế推送 phân cấp thông minh
Cao thủ thực sự sẽ không để Đinh Đinh GitHub trở thành máy tạo tiếng ồn, mà biết cách sử dụng bộ lọc chiến lược để đạt hiệu quả chính xác. Thông báo tràn lan chỉ dẫn đến "mệt mỏi cảnh báo", cuối cùng khiến mọi người tắt thông báo hoặc tự động bỏ qua. Vì vậy, bắt buộc phải thiết kế một logic thông báo phân cấp. Ví dụ, đối với hành động merge vào nhánh master/main, có thể tự động @ người phụ trách module liên quan và kèm theo liên kết triển khai, đảm bảo đội QA có thể can thiệp kiểm thử ngay lập tức; lỗi ưu tiên cao (P0) thì lập tức hiển thị thẻ nổi bật và kích hoạt nhắc nhở mention; còn các commit hàng ngày hoặc cập nhật tài liệu thì có thể xếp vào dạng ghi nhận im lặng hoặc báo cáo tổng hợp hàng ngày. Ngoài ra, tận dụng tối đa định dạng đa phương tiện mà robot Đinh Đinh hỗ trợ, chuyển đổi dữ liệu JSON gốc thành thẻ Markdown rõ ràng, đẹp mắt, thêm tiêu đề, khối màu sắc, nút bấm và siêu liên kết, nâng cao đáng kể hiệu suất tiếp nhận thông tin. Nên xây dựng cấu trúc ba tầng: sự kiện khẩn cấp đẩy ngay lập tức, mức độ trung bình tổng hợp định kỳ, hoạt động ít xảy ra chỉ lưu trữ tra cứu. Như vậy, Đinh Đinh GitHub mới thực sự đóng vai trò "trung tâm thông minh", chứ không đơn thuần là một cái loa thông báo khác.
Đinh Đinh GitHub tích hợp sâu với CI/CD, hiện thực hóa quá trình giao nhận trực quan
Khi cơ chế thông báo cơ bản đã ổn định, bước tiếp theo là nâng tầm tích hợp Đinh Đinh GitHub lên mức cao hơn — tích hợp toàn diện vào quy trình CI/CD. Trong trạng thái lý tưởng, từ việc gửi mã, chạy kiểm thử đến triển khai sản phẩm, mỗi bước đều phải có phản hồi trực quan tức thì. Thông qua cấu hình webhook trên GitHub Actions hoặc Jenkins, trạng thái build, thời gian, người kích hoạt và liên kết log có thể được đóng gói thành thẻ cấu trúc gửi đến nhóm Đinh Đinh. Ví dụ, khi triển khai production thất bại, robot tự động gửi thẻ cảnh báo màu đỏ và @ kỹ sư trực liên quan, đồng thời đính kèm ngăn xếp lỗi và liên kết Job Jenkins, rút ngắn đáng kể MTTR (thời gian sửa chữa trung bình). Ngược lại, build staging thành công sẽ được hiển thị bằng bản tóm tắt màu xanh đơn giản, tránh làm phiền. Văn hóa "giao nhận trực quan" này phá vỡ rào cản giữa các bộ phận, giúp đội sản phẩm, vận hành và ban quản lý đều nắm bắt được nhịp độ phát hành mà không cần họp để hỏi "Phiên bản đã ra chưa?". Quan trọng hơn, nó thúc đẩy tinh thần DevOps được hiện thực hóa — khi tất cả đều thấy rõ toàn bộ quy trình, việc truy trách nhiệm và hợp tác trở nên thuận lợi hơn, chi phí giao tiếp giảm mạnh.
Đinh Đinh GitHub thúc đẩy mô hình cộng tác chủ động - chuẩn mực mới
Sự thay đổi sâu sắc nhất đến từ việc tích hợp Đinh Đinh GitHub đã định hình lại mô hình hành vi của nhóm như thế nào — chuyển từ phản hồi thụ động sang cảnh báo chủ động. Trước đây, vấn đề thường chỉ được phát hiện sau khi tích tụ vài giờ hoặc thậm chí sang ngày hôm sau, nhưng nay ngay cả khi pipeline sập lúc 2 giờ sáng cũng có thể kích hoạt cảnh báo tức thì, kỹ sư trực còn chưa tỉnh dậy đã nhận được đầy đủ thông tin chẩn đoán. Tần suất họp giảm rõ rệt, buổi họp sáng không còn dùng để "đuổi tiến độ" mà tập trung giải quyết tắc nghẽn và lên kế hoạch phát triển, bởi mọi hoạt động đã được ghi rõ trong nhóm. Chúng tôi từng phân tích dữ liệu ban đầu và phát hiện việc thông báo quá mức gây ra hiệu ứng "Sói đến rồi!" — do đó đã điều chỉnh quy tắc lọc webhook, chỉ gửi cảnh báo nổi bật với nhánh cụ thể hoặc loại lỗi nhất định, còn lại thì lưu trữ để thống kê. Tư duy tối ưu dựa trên dữ liệu này dần xây dựng nên văn hóa "tự động hóa là ưu tiên": báo cáo lỗi do bot ghi nhận, assign tự động đánh dấu người chịu trách nhiệm, các trao đổi lặp lại do máy xử lý. Kết quả là kỹ sư được giải phóng nguồn lực trí tuệ quý giá, tập trung vào các nhiệm vụ sáng tạo hơn — chẳng hạn như hệ thống AI hỗ trợ review code mà chúng tôi đang phát triển gần đây, chính là nhờ khoảng thời gian và năng lượng dư ra từ cơ sở hạ tầng cộng tác hiệu quả này.